Cultural Heritage
The Blue Ridge National Heritage Area is a land of living traditions. The rich cultural mosaic of the North Carolina mountains and foothills has its origins in three separate continents—North America, Europe, and Africa. The mountains themselves have helped to protect and nurture this cultural mosaic by providing a degree of relative isolation from the rest of the state and nation.
Three major strands of this rich tapestry of cultural heritage are:
• Cherokee heritage
• Scots-Irish heritage
• African-American heritage
